Who We Are
The Community Service Centre offers a variety of supports in the areas of employment, budget counselling, and transportation for seniors along with accessible transit for people with disabilities, or mobile aids.
The Community Service Centre works to increase the self confidence and job search skills participants need to find long term employment and build the career of their choice. Working together in a one-on-one or group environment, we focus on your needs specifically, through our employment programs. |

Enhanced Career Bridging (ECB) helps people in obtaining and maintaining employment. The program is an 8 week class, and 6 week work placement. The program is eligible for Education and Training Incentive (ETI).
|
The Job Finding Club is focused on individuals working together and finding
opportunities in the hidden job market. |
TIOW assists people ages 55-65 in finding work. The program consists of 8 weeks in-class, followed by a 6-week work placement. The program is eligible for the Education and Training Incentive.

Two Miles for Mary
For nearly 40 years, the radio campaign "Two Miles for Mary" has been a long-time fundraising staple for the CSC. It raises money for the Seniors Transportation service and in turn, our local seniors as well.
